Simon P H Mee et al.
Chemistry (Weinheim an der Bergstrasse, Germany), 11(11), 3294-3308 (2005-03-24)
The combination of copper(I) iodide and cesium fluoride significantly enhances the Stille reaction. After extensive optimisation, a variety of electronically unfavourable and sterically hindered substrates were coupled in very high yields under mild conditions.
